DARPA "Defense Advanced Research Project Agency" XM-3 Deployment Package

Manufacturer: Iron Brigade Armory 

Condition: This weapon system was issued and deployed over seas so the condition of the rifles matches the life the rifle lived.

History: This XM-3 started life in November of 2006 at IBA (Iron Brigade Armory) where DARPA (The contract winner) sold them to the Marines in December of 2006 the weapon system was utilized in Iraq until April 2007. Once the weapon systems were no longer being utilized, they were sent back to IBA. In September of 2007 where the Warrior Training Center at Fort Benning requested two XM-3's to be utilized in the International Sniper Competition on Oct 28 - Nov 3. During the competition This XM-3 took 3rd place and its brother took 4th place both weapon systems were utilized by a very green National Guard team (Which shows how well these weapon systems performed based on how well the two did with them). Then in 2009 the weapon system re-deployed to Afghanistan where it stayed in country until sometime in 2010. After coming back from overseas the AMU (Army Marksmanship Unit) took possession of the rifle until 2014 where it was then re-barreled and called back to IBA. IBA finally sold the rifle to the individual I purchased the weapon system from.

So What Made The XM3 So Different?

  • The receivers were clip slotted to accept the reverse-engineered titanium picatinny rail (IBA Design) to fit firmly.
  • The receivers’ internal threads were opened up to 1.070” to allow a perfectly true alignment with the bolt face and chamber/bore dimension. The chamber was cut to accept M118LR ammo.
  • The titanium recoil lug was built with the 1.070” diameter opening for the larger-barrel threads and surface ground true.
  • The stainless steel magazine box was hand fitted and welded to eliminate movement when assembled.
  • The stocks were custom made for the project.
  • The barreled actions were bedded in titanium Devcon and Marine Tex to allow for decades of hard use without losing torque or consistency.
  • Nightforce made a full 1 MOA elevation adjustment on their NXS 3.5-15X50’s to allow for faster dope changes at distance. These scopes had 1/4 MOA windage.
